Interestingly too, there’s good reason to believe Hazard and Mane both peaked in the 2018/19 season, which is where we’ll turn to try and find out who boasted the best stats in their splendor.
Although, yes, Hazard may have won the PFA Players’ Player of the Year award in 2014/15, we’re inclined to think it was his final year at Stamford Bridge that actually saw his best performances. .
He may not have won the Premier League title like he did four years ago, but he has produced both more goals and more assists in this campaign to land a transfer to Real Madrid.
And as for Mane, it’s a pretty straightforward selection as he won the Premier League Golden Boot and the Champions League title to earn himself a fourth-place Ballon d’Or.

Mane holds on
It might just be us, but sometimes it feels like the Senegalese winger gets lost in the mix of legendary Premier League wingers because he’s so often compared unfavorably to Salah.
As such, many fans will have expected Hazard to roll Mane at his peak, but that’s just not the case with the two players back and forth in a titanic statistical battle.
Hazard has never scored as many Premier League goals in a season as Mane did in 2018/19, although he is going wild in the assists charts by scoring 14 more goals on a plate than rivals Liverpool.
The Chelsea icon is holding strong in attacking data despite also scoring fewer goals, and enjoys some sort of demolition work in the squad play rankings with an array of fabulous passing stats.
But Mane was still dispossessed less often and provided more balls, before reasserting himself in the defensive stats with more tackles, interceptions, clean sheets and more.
All in all, you might say Prime Hazard pretty much sneaks around with a fuller set of data – give or take his clear defensive weaknesses – but the fact that you can discuss him anyway says a lot.
Hazard is one of the most technically gifted players the Premier League has ever seen, so Mane taking on his best talent shows how much he will be missed in English football.
